For the business season Nizhny Novgorod Airport launches additional flight to St. Petersburg

From October 1, Nizhny Novgorod International Airport adds one more daily flight to St. Petersburg to its timetable. Ak Bars Aero is staring the service having signed an agreement on the development of regional transportation with the airport and the Government of the Nizhny Novgorod Region in July. Direct scheduled flight to the northern capital will be operated on the 50-seat aircraft CRJ-200, departure from Nizhniy Novgorod at 17:45, flight time - 1 hour 45 minutes.

Let’s recall, that the regular service between Nizhny Novgorod and St. Petersburg was resumed in June 2011 by UTair after a 15-year break. Since then, the daily morning flight has established itself in the timetable of the Nizhny Novgorod aviation hub, and become the second popular domestic flight carried out from Nizhny Novgorod Airport. Average passenger load keeps at 90% or higher.

- When we launched scheduled flights to St. Petersburg a year and a half s ago, we predicted the strong demand for this destination, and our estimates came true. Furthermore, in the beginning of 2012, it became apparent that the demand for this route is beyond the capacity of one flight a day, commented MANN General Director Alexander Sinelnikov. - This is why, when developing specific actions under the regional development program, and planning to open 10 new routes (5 to the west and 5 to east of the country), primary attention was paid to launching of the St.Petersburg’s flight.

Additional daily flight during the autumn/winter period will make the Nizhny Novgorod Airport timetable more convenient for passengers:

Departure from Nizhny Novgorod / Arrival at St.Petersburg

Departure from St.Petersburg / Arrival at Nizhny Novgorod

UTair

07:40 / 09:40

21:00 / 23:00

AK BARS AERO

17:45 / 19:30

09:40 / 11:25

Moreover, for greater mobility of passengers, check-in at the St.Petersburg destination closes 20 minutes before the departure.
